Eligibility and Application Process
To apply for a Youth Action Grant, applicants must meet specific eligibility criteria set forth by The Starbucks Foundation. Generally, these grants are available to individuals aged 15 to 24 who are passionate about making a difference in their communities. The foundation encourages applications from diverse backgrounds, including those from underrepresented groups, ensuring that a wide range of perspectives and experiences are represented in the projects funded.
This inclusivity is crucial for addressing the multifaceted challenges faced by communities today. The application process itself is designed to be user-friendly, allowing young people to articulate their ideas clearly and effectively. Applicants are typically required to submit a project proposal outlining their objectives, target audience, and anticipated impact.
Additionally, they may need to provide a budget detailing how the grant funds will be utilized. The foundation emphasizes the importance of collaboration and encourages applicants to partner with local organizations or community groups to enhance their project’s reach and effectiveness. Once submitted, proposals are reviewed by a panel of experts who assess their feasibility, innovation, and potential for positive impact.
